How old does a car have to be to be a classic in Texas?

A car is considered a classic in Texas if it’s at least 25 years old, is owned solely as a collector’s item, and is not a replica or aftermarket vehicle. When a vehicle in Texas meets these requirements, the owner can register it as an antique vehicle, which will limit the car’s use.

How often should you drive a classic car?

In fact, one of the best things you can do for your car is drive it regularly– once per month is the recommended minimum. One of the biggest issues with old cars is that they’re not used regularly. If you leave your car in the garage for too long, its seals and rubber components can dry out and cause leaks.

Where is the word classic from?

Etymology. The word classics is derived from the Latin adjective classicus, meaning “belonging to the highest class of citizens.” The word was originally used to describe the members of the Patricians, the highest class in ancient Rome.

What is classic design?

A design classic is an industrially manufactured object with timeless aesthetic value. … Thus, design classics are often strikingly simple, going to the essence, and are described with words like iconic, neat, valuable or having meaning.
